COLOMBO (News 1st) - The Government Medical Officers' Association (GMOA) is scheduled to launch a fresh island-wide strike starting at 8:00 AM today (09). 

The strike was called in response to the Ministry of Health allegedly violating agreed-upon conditions regarding post-internship medical appointments. 

The GMOA claims the Ministry proceeded with appointments while bypassing the terms previously settled with the association.

Previously, The GMOA temporarily suspended a multi-day strike at 8:00 AM on April 06. 

Strike resumes after negotiations stalled.

A discussion between the GMOA and the Minister of Health and Media, Dr. Nalinda Jayatissa, was originally slated to take place today.
